The Federation
 
I checked with both AIT and FIT and neither agency has nor will they issue a Carnet. Further, the HKAA issues Carnets ONLY for bikes registered in Hong Kong.

One thing that you must understand about China is that all laws are subject to local interpretation and that if a border guard wants to say no he will say no. Trying to get around that is very difficult, if not impossible.

Forgive me for saying this but you are thinking with a non-Chinese mind and that is a real problem. To do anything here requires document and stamps (chops) on documents. It is almost like Saudi in that respect, rather than to say yes or no, all you get is tomorrow or later or the leader isn't here now.

Regardless of what the law states, if you don't follow the Chinese way (which maybe written to provide income to travel agents and guides) you will not ride here regardless of what any law states

Entry may appear open but in fact it is not.

Sorry to be the bearer of bad tidings but this is my experience.
